Digital Business Technology Stack: The Ultimate Blueprint for Building a Successful Digital Business
Establishing a digital business can want to navigate a maze of tools, platforms, and strategies. Whether you are an emerging entrepreneur or scaling an existing company, you will need to assemble the right technology stack and outline cohesive workflows. Below, we have created a reader-friendly roadmap that takes a broad approach to building a successful online venture. Enjoy a clear format, bullet points, and subheadings that make skimming easy while ensuring you will not miss any essential details.
1. Secure Your Domain and Hosting
A solid digital presence starts with a memorable domain name and a reliable hosting environment.
Domain Name Tips:
- Aim for something short, easy to spell, and memorable (e.g., brandname.com).
- Where possible, include your core product or service in the domain to reflect your brand identity.
- Use reputable registrars such as GoDaddy, Namecheap, or Google Domains.
Hosting Options:
- Shared Hosting: Budget-friendly but can be slow during peak traffic.
- Virtual Private Server (VPS): You get more control and freedom compared to shared hosting.
- Managed WordPress Hosting: Ideal if you primarily use WordPress (e.g., WP Engine, Kinsta).
- Cloud Hosting (AWS, GCP, Azure): Scalable, pay-as-you-go model tailored to fast-growing or enterprise-level businesses.
Why It Matters: Your domain is the foundation of your brand, and high-quality hosting ensures that visitors enjoy a quick, stable experience on your site.

2. Build Your Website or E-Commerce Platform
Your site is your digital storefront, so it should be user-friendly, visually appealing, and easy to manage.
Content Management Systems (CMS):
- WordPress: Largest ecosystem of themes and plugins.
- Drupal: Highly customizable for complex websites.
- Joomla: Middle ground in complexity between WordPress and Drupal.
E-Commerce Solutions:
- Shopify: All-in-one platform designed for quick setup with minimal technical expertise.
- WooCommerce (WordPress): Great if you already have a WordPress site and want total control.
- BigCommerce: Robust features for medium to large businesses.
- Magento: Highly scalable but requires advanced technical knowledge.
Landing Page Builders:
- ClickFunnels, Unbounce, or Leadpages to create specialized, high-conversion pages for campaigns and product launches.
Key Considerations for Your Platform:
- Scalability – Will the site hold up if your traffic doubles overnight?
- Ease of Use – Can you quickly add or modify content without specialized coding skills?
- Flexibility – Does it support any future marketing tools or plugins you might need?
3. Optimize Website Performance and Security
If your website is slow or not secure, people might leave and trust you less.
Speed Enhancement Tools:
- Content Delivery Network (CDN): Services like Cloudflare, Fastly, or AWS CloudFront place your site’s resources on servers worldwide, reducing loading times.
- Caching Plugins: Tools like W3 Total Cache or WP Rocket store static versions of your pages to improve response speed.
Security Best Practices:
- SSL Certificate: Enable HTTPS to encrypt data. Free options from Let Us Encrypt or paid solutions from DigiCert are available.
- Firewall and Malware Scanning: Sucuri and Wordfence (for WordPress) help detect and neutralize threats.
- Regular Updates: Outdated plugins and themes can be entry points for hackers. Keep software current.
Why It Matters: Performance and security directly influence search engine rankings, user trust, and overall conversions.
4. Leverage Marketing and Growth Tools
From SEO to paid ads, a well-rounded approach keeps your brand visible to potential customers.
4.1 Search Engine Optimization (SEO)
- Keyword Research: Use Ahrefs, Semrush, or Google Keyword Planner to uncover key phrases with decent search volume and low competition.
- On-Page Optimization: Implement meta titles, descriptions, header tags, and alt text. Tools like Yoast SEO or Rank Math simplify these tasks for WordPress.
- Link Building: Acquire backlinks from reputable sources via guest posting, PR mentions, or industry partnerships.
4.2 Content Marketing
- Editorial Calendar: Plan and schedule topics using Trello, Asana, or Monday.com.
- Writing Optimization: Grammarly helps with grammar checks; Surfer SEO or Frase guides keyword density and structure.
- Repurposing Content: Turn in-depth blog posts into podcasts or infographics to maximize reach.
4.3 Social Media Management
- Scheduling & Automation: Buffer, Hootsuite, or Sprout Social help maintain a consistent posting schedule across platforms.
- Monitoring Mentions: Set up alerts or use listening tools to quickly respond to customer feedback or questions.
- Automated Sharing: Zapier or IFTTT can push content from your website directly to your social channels.
4.4 Email Marketing
- Email Platforms: Mailchimp, ConvertKit, or ActiveCampaign for growing email lists and nurturing leads.
- Segmentation: Separate your audience based on behaviors (e.g., past purchases, links clicked).
- Automation Flows: Welcome sequences abandoned cart reminders, and re-engagement campaigns can boost conversions.
4.5 Paid Advertising
- Channels: Google Ads, Facebook Ads, Instagram Ads, LinkedIn Ads, or Pinterest Ads (depending on your niche).
- Tracking: Link campaigns with Google Analytics 4, Meta Pixel, or Google Tag Manager for accurate data.
- A/B Testing: Experiment with different ad creatives, headlines, and audiences to optimize ROI.

5. Enhance Customer Relationships and Support
Delighting your customers fosters loyalty and generates valuable word-of-mouth marketing.
Popular CRMs:
- Salesforce: Enterprise-grade with numerous integrations.
- HubSpot: Free CRM features plus optional marketing, sales, and service hubs.
- Zoho CRM: A budget-friendly, all-in-one solution.
Customer Support and Helpdesks:
- Zendesk, Freshdesk, or Help Scout streamline ticket management, ensuring no query goes unanswered.
- Real-time support via Intercom, Drift, or Tidio encourages quick resolutions and positive customer experiences.
Community Engagement:
- Launch a forum using Discourse or phpBB.
- Create private memberships with platforms like Circle or Tribe.
- Encourage user-generated content (UGC) or host Q&A sessions on Facebook Groups, LinkedIn Groups, or Discord.
6. Streamline Operations & Project Management
Behind every successful digital business lies well-coordinated teamwork and efficient processes.
Project Management Tools:
- Trello: Visual boards for simple task tracking.
- Asana: Flexible for small to mid-sized teams with timeline and workflow views.
- Monday.com: Highly customizable, with automation features and integration options.
- Jira: Tailored for software development teams, complete with agile sprints, user stories, and bug tracking.
Team Collaboration:
- Slack or Microsoft Teams for real-time discussions and file sharing.
- Google Workspace or Microsoft 365 for collaborative document editing.
Workflow Automation:
- Zapier or Make (formerly Integromat) integrate different apps and trigger tasks automatically.
- AWS Lambda or Google Cloud Functions manage more advanced, code-based automations.
7. Measure, Analyze, and Report
Data-driven decisions minimize guesswork and improve return on investment (ROI).
Analytics Platforms:
- Google Analytics 4 (GA4) tracks user behaviour, conversions, and funnels.
- Mixpanel or Adobe Analytics offer advanced event tracking for web and mobile apps.
Heatmaps & User Recordings:
- Hotjar, Crazy Egg, or Microsoft Clarity show how users interact with your pages, revealing bottlenecks or confusing layouts.
Dashboards & Visualization:
- Looker Studio (formerly Google Data Studio) turns raw numbers into shareable, dynamic reports.
- Power BI or Tableau for more sophisticated data modelling and enterprise-level dashboards.
A/B Testing Tools:
- VWO or Optimizely to compare page variations.
- Google Optimize (if available) for basic, free split testing (note its planned sunset, so exploring alternatives is wise).
8. Build Financial & Legal Infrastructure
A stable backend ensures smooth transactions and compliance with global regulations.
Accounting & Bookkeeping:
- QuickBooks, Xero, or FreshBooks: Automate invoice creation, expense tracking, and financial reporting.
- Wave: A free option for smaller businesses or freelancers.
Payment Processing:
- Stripe, PayPal, or Braintree for secure credit card handling.
- Chargebee or Recurly manage recurring bills, subscriptions, and discount codes.
Compliance Basics:
- GDPR / CCPA: Understand your responsibilities around data protection and user privacy.
- Cookie Consent Tools: Cookiebot or OneTrust for managing user consent and data collection.
- Legal Documents: Termly, LegalZoom, or drafting with a professional to ensure disclaimers, Terms of Service, and Privacy Policies.
9. Prioritize Cybersecurity & Data Protection
Online threats are an ever-present risk, so initiative-taking cybersecurity is crucial.
Security Monitoring:
- AWS Security Hub, Azure Security Center, GCP Security Command Center centralize vulnerability scanning.
- Penetration Testing: Engage ethical hackers or services like HackerOne to uncover potential weaknesses.
Backup & Disaster Recovery:
- CodeGuard, VaultPress, or JetBackup for automated backups.
- Store critical data offsite, using AWS S3 or Google Cloud Storage for extra redundancy.
Identity & Access Management:
- Use two-factor authentication (2FA) with Google Authenticator, Authy, or Duo.
- Encourage team members to secure credentials in 1Password or Dashlane.
10. Scale & Optimize Performance
Planning for growth means implementing robust infrastructure that can manage higher traffic and complexity.
Cloud Infrastructure:
- AWS Elastic Load Balancing or Google Cloud Load Balancing distribute incoming traffic, preventing server overload.
- Kubernetes orchestrates containers for modular, scalable deployments.
Monitoring & Alerting:
- Datadog, New Relic, or AWS CloudWatch track resource usage (CPU, memory, network) and send alerts when predefined thresholds are exceeded.
Continuous Integration/Continuous Delivery (CI/CD):
- GitHub Actions, GitLab CI, Jenkins, or CircleCI automate code testing and deployment.
- Fewer manual steps reduce human error and speed up feature releases.

11. Embrace Strategic & Operational Best Practices
Succeeding online requires not just tools, but methods that keep your organization agile.
Lean Startup Mindset:
- Start with an MVP (Minimum Viable Product) to quickly validate your core ideas.
- Solicit ongoing feedback, refine, and iterate to align with customer needs.
Data-Driven Decisions:
- Track CAC (Customer Acquisition Cost), LTV (Lifetime Value), churn rates, and funnel conversions.
- Let these metrics guide budget allocations and marketing campaigns.
Agile Workflows:
- Scrum or Kanban boards help break down projects into smaller, manageable sprints.
- Focus on continuous improvement, implementing feedback loops at each iteration.
12. Design a User-Centric Interface
User experience (UX) and user interface (UI) best practices can significantly increase your conversion rates.
User Feedback Loop:
- Surveys via SurveyMonkey or Typeform.
- UserTesting sessions to witness real interactions.
Key UX Principles:
- Simplify Navigation: Clear menus, logical site hierarchy, consistent categories.
- Mobile Responsiveness: Adapt layouts for smartphones and tablets.
- Accessibility: Alt tags for images, sufficient colour contrast, keyboard-friendly navigation.
13. Stay Compliant with Global Regulations
Ignoring legal obligations can lead to costly fines and reputational damage.
- GDPR for EU residents: Consent forms, clear data usage policies, the right to be forgotten.
- CCPA for California: Transparency around data collection and opt-out mechanisms.
- PCI-DSS: For businesses managing credit card information, ensure data is encrypted and stored securely.
Industry-Specific Regulations:
- HIPAA for medical data in the US.
- FINRA or SEC for financial institutions.
- Ensure you consult specialized legal advisors for niche requirements.

14. Document Everything
Solid documentation fosters consistency and elevates your team’s performance.
Standard Operating Procedures (SOPs):
- Outline step-by-step processes for tasks like new hire onboarding, client intake, or content publication.
- Keep these updated and easily accessible (e.g., in Google Drive or an internal Wiki).
Training & Development:
- Host internal workshops for new tools or procedures.
- Encourage an environment of continuous learning to adapt to evolving technologies.
15. Final Insights for Long-Term Growth
Developing a digital business involves continuous improvement, strategic thinking, and disciplined execution. Even the best stack of tools will not replace the importance of a well-rounded approach that ties together performance, security, usability, and compliance.
Here are a few final pointers to guide your journey:
- Start Lean & Expand Gradually: Focus on high-impact areas first—like a dependable website and basic marketing funnels—before diving into more advanced tools.
- Be Customer-Obsessed: Every process, from product development to marketing, should reflect a deep understanding of your audience’s needs.
- Test & Iterate: Embrace A/B testing, user feedback, and analytics data to continuously refine your approach.
- Stay Current: Technologies evolve, and consumer expectations change rapidly. Keep a watchful eye on industry developments and pivot where necessary.
- Invest in Security: A single breach can undo years of brand-building. Strong security safeguards your reputation and fosters customer trust.
Following these guidelines will enable you to forge a dependable, profitable digital business capable of weathering market shifts and scaling smoothly. By methodically addressing each aspect—from hosting and security to marketing and community engagement—you will empower your online venture to stand out, delight customers, and drive sustainable growth.
Get in touch with us
Additional Tips & Points:
- #1: Always keep an eye on your site’s load time. Even a two-second delay can negatively impact conversions and SEO.
- #2: Use retargeting campaigns to bring back site visitors who didn’t convert on their first visit.
- #3: Regularly evaluate keyword trends. Terms with previously low traffic may gain momentum, offering fresh SEO opportunities.
- #4: Integrate user reviews and testimonials to build trust—this user-generated content often improves SEO as well.
- #5: If you plan to expand internationally, consider multi-language support and localized domain extensions.
- Keyword Advice: Identify synonyms and related terms to support your primary keywords. For example, “online business solutions,” “scalable e-commerce,” “cloud hosting platforms,” “marketing automation tools,” and “CRM solutions for enterprises.”
- Growth Insights: Leverage social proof, influencer partnerships, and affiliate programs to boost your brand’s credibility and reach new audiences.
- Final Word: Consistency, continuous improvement, and customer focus will form the pillars of a truly resilient digital brand.
Unlocking the “Secrets to Start“
Unveil the secrets to beginning any venture with success. Practical tips and insights to ensure a powerful start.
Follow on LinkedInDiscover more from Techno Evangelist
Subscribe to get the latest posts sent to your email.